πŸ’­ What is CERT? πŸ’­
 
The Community Emergency Response Team (CERT) program equips volunteers with the skills needed to assist during emergencies and disasters. Training covers fire safety, disaster medical operations, light search and rescue, and team coordination. Whether supporting first responders or helping neighbors in a crisis, CERT members play a vital role when it matters most.
